Unsupported nanoporous gold catalyst for highly selective hydrogenation of quinolines.

Mei Yan1, Tienan Jin, Qiang Chen, Hon Eong Ho, Takeshi Fujita, Lu-Yang Chen, Ming Bao, Ming-Wei Chen, Naoki Asao, Yoshinori Yamamoto.   

Abstract

For the first time, the highly efficient and regioselective hydrogenation of quinoline derivatives to 1,2,3,4-tetrahydroquinolines using unsupported nanoporous gold (AuNPore) as a catalyst and organosilane with water as a hydrogen source is reported. The AuNPore catalyst can be readily recovered and reused without any loss of catalytic activity.
